The Concept

Some things are best understood by touch: a dovetail joint, the weight of solid wood, the way light changes depending on how a shade is made.

The Dresdner Zimmer was founded on this conviction: that craft is not a category, but an experience. It is a collaborative platform bringing together makers and designers with a broader national and international reach, working at the intersection of tradition and contemporary relevance.

 

The initiative grew from a shared observation: many small and mid-sized studios and workshops in the furniture and interior sector produce work of genuine quality and distinction, yet often lack the visibility or structural reach their work would deserve. The market rewards scale. Craft rewards attention. Finding a balance between these two realities is the central challenge.

Rather than compete in isolation, a group of committed partners chose to work differently. Together, they form a platform for communication and collaboration — a collective voice that extends further than any single studio could sustain alone. The aim is not uniformity, but critical mass: a portfolio broad enough to be compelling, and coherent enough to carry meaning.

What unites the partners is not a shared aesthetic, but a shared standard: rigorous design, entirely handcrafted production, and a deliberate commitment to keeping both making and meaning local — strengthening regional supply chains and consumption patterns as a form of practice, not just principle.


The project launched in 2023 with a pop-up exhibition at Designcampus Pillnitz. Eight partners presented work from their current collections, installed within the castle’s historic rooms. The pairing was intentional: objects made for everyday use — sofas, lighting, wall coverings — placed in quiet dialogue with centuries of applied craft. No apology for the commercial, no claim to pure artistic autonomy — just well-made things, honestly presented.

The response was strong enough to deepen the ambition. A permanent showroom is the next step — a dedicated space where the platform’s guiding principle can be experienced directly: craft must be experienced to be understood.

That space will also serve as an open invitation — to new partners, new disciplines, and a broader representation of what regional making can become when given room to speak.

We believe a living craft culture depends on this combination: the aesthetic argument and the economic one, held together, neither sacrificed for the other.

The chair
noord is inspired by the vibrant atmosphere of Amsterdam Noord — a district shaped by creative spaces, industrial structures, and a distinctive urban energy. Influences from the NDSM Wharf, with its studios, workshops, and container architecture, are reflected in the chair’s clear silhouette and confident material presence.
Crafted from solid oak, noord combines precise proportions with a calm and durable character. The coloured editions are produced in ash wood, whose fine grain adds a lighter and more refined expression. Carefully executed mortise-and-tenon joints and hand-finished bevels on the solid wood seat emphasise the chair’s tactile quality and lasting comfort.

The colour palette references the tones of shipping containers and industrial surfaces found throughout Amsterdam Noord: deep black, dark red, sage green, and natural oak create a balance between expressive accents and understated materiality. Custom colour editions allow for additional variations and project-specific adaptations.

Whether used in offices, co-working environments, or residential interiors, noord functions as a versatile seating object that combines craftsmanship, clarity, and a strong visual identity.

BC2 Lounge Chair Family
Manufacturer:
Bisch-Chandaroff Werkstätten
Design:
stephanpartner
Contact:
info@bisch-chandaroff.de

The BC2 Lounge Chair Family is a series of handcrafted seating furniture for residential and commercial interiors. Defined by a calm and reduced design language, the system combines modular seat and backrest elements that can be assembled through a precise plug-in construction. Three seat widths and three backrest heights create a versatile family of armchairs and sofas that can be further individualised through a selection of loose back cushions.

Particular attention is given to the upholstery details: all covers are sewn by hand, and the carefully curated »Savile Row« range of fabrics references traditional tailoring craftsmanship and its contemporary interpretation.

Following an extended development process and the evaluation of multiple concepts, Bisch-Chandaroff Werkstätten decided to realise the BC2 Series as a central product line. Alongside contemporary design, the focus lies on local production, exclusive craftsmanship, and a conscious approach to sourcing, manufacturing, and durability.

Since its founding in 1936, Bisch-Chandaroff Werkstätten in Dresden has embodied craftsmanship and reliable service in the interior sector.
Originating as a traditional upholstery workshop, the company specializes in custom-made textile solutions for interiors. Serving predominantly regional clients, it creates contemporary and internationally inspired designs for both private and commercial spaces, combining technical precision with aesthetic sensitivity.

Leuchten Manufactur Wurzen
Based in:
Wurzen
Contact:
Gabriele Pötzsch
Sector:
Restoration / Reconstruction / Custom Lighting

»The master’s hand is the finest tool.«
Since its foundation in 1862, this principle has remained central to the work of Leuchten Manufactur Wurzen.
The company restores and reconstructs historic lighting fixtures and produces exclusive custom-made luminaires. Whether faithful reproduction or contemporary reinterpretation, its own designs, templates, models, and expertise in surface finishes continue to form the foundation of the practice. Projects are realised from the initial design through to installation on site.

Vitrinen- und Glasbau REIER GmbH was founded in 1988 in Lauta, Saxony. Today, the company is an innovative medium-sized enterprise and one of the few highly specialised manufacturers of museum interiors and showcase systems worldwide.

The company develops and produces high-quality solutions designed to protect and preserve valuable cultural artefacts while meeting the highest standards of design, functionality, security, and conservation. Its products are defined by a high level of craftsmanship, continuously monitored through a comprehensive quality management system.
